My younger son, Alex, was 16 yesterday (where did the last 16 years go) and has been playing a lot of golf recently, so instead of the usual cricket card he got one with a golf theme. He's got a great sense of humour so I wanted a funny image and after seeeing this one somewhere in Blogland I managed to track it down to 'Karens Doodles'. Fortunately it was a digital image and not a rubber stamp so it wasn't a problem that I was on the last minute as usual.
It's 20cms square and I've used Funky Hand DP's so that I can enter it into the current challenge at Get Funky which is Boys, Boys, Boys. The papers are a combination, some from the 'Jovial Man' collection on Colour Me Happy and the other from the latest freebie. ProMarkers were used for colouring the image and the flag was created to enable me to add his age.
I really like the finished card but after it was too late I had the idea to use a scorecard instead of one of the rectangles - well maybe next time.
